Physical description
Music sheet cover for The German Band Quadrille. A brass band plays in the street causing havoc to all passers by.

Marks and inscriptions
'The German Band / Placid Place / Alfred Concanen del / Concanen Siebe & Co. Lith 12, Frith St. London / Quadrille / Composed by / C H R Marriott / ENT. STA. HALL. Solo or Duet' (Text printed on front cover.)
